The Russia acoustic insulation market is projected to experience notable expansion by 2030, influenced by the nation’s evolving construction practices, growing urban population, and increasing public and governmental awareness of noise pollution. Rising demand for acoustic comfort in both residential and commercial infrastructure is steering the market toward advanced and efficient insulation solutions. The continued development of large-scale infrastructure projects, such as housing programs, transportation hubs, and educational institutions, has underscored the need for quality soundproofing materials. Moreover, noise control is becoming a standard design consideration across many urban developments due to heightened sensitivity to health issues linked with prolonged exposure to high decibel levels. Issues such as stress, sleep disorders, reduced work productivity, and cardiovascular health are compelling individuals and institutions to invest in acoustic comfort as a necessity rather than a luxury. In metropolitan areas like Moscow, Kazan, and Novosibirsk, the noise pollution from traffic, construction, and industrial activity has made sound insulation an essential component in modern building practices.
There is also a growing understanding among developers and architects about the synergy between thermal and acoustic insulation, leading to integrated solutions that serve dual purposes ensuring comfort while improving building energy efficiency. Additionally, global building standards such as LEED and BREEAM, which are gaining traction in Russia, often include acoustic performance as a critical factor in their evaluation systems. From a manufacturing and technological standpoint, the acoustic insulation market in Russia is undergoing structural changes driven by both domestic demand and external influences. Geopolitical shifts, particularly economic sanctions and import restrictions, have pushed the Russian market to develop more self-reliant production capabilities. This has led to a notable increase in local manufacturing of insulation products that are tailored to Russia's specific climatic and regulatory conditions.

Companies are investing in research and development to formulate high-performance materials that address both acoustic and thermal needs while remaining cost-effective and easy to install. Innovation is playing a pivotal role, with advancements in nanotechnology, material science, and automated manufacturing processes allowing producers to create lighter, thinner, and more durable insulation solutions. These developments are especially important for retrofitting aging Soviet-era buildings that lack modern insulation standards, where installation challenges often limit the viability of traditional bulky materials. Furthermore, Russia’s strategic focus on infrastructure modernization, especially in health, education, and military sectors, is driving large-volume procurement of high-grade acoustic insulation. The demand is further amplified by stringent building norms that emphasize indoor environmental quality, particularly in public-use buildings. Contractors and developers are also seeing acoustic insulation as a value-adding feature that enhances property appeal and marketability.
The preference for domestically manufactured materials is being supported through subsidies and public-private partnerships, enabling the emergence of smaller regional producers who cater to local markets with customized solutions. Glass wool, due to its affordability, ease of application, and effective noise-absorbing capabilities, remains a staple material in both residential and commercial construction. It is frequently used in partition walls, ceilings, and HVAC systems, where its thermal benefits are an added advantage. Stone wool or rock wool is another dominant material, particularly in applications that demand superior fire resistance and moisture tolerance. Its dense composition and durability make it a preferred choice for industrial and high-performance buildings. Fiberglass continues to serve as a go-to material for acoustic ceiling panels, duct insulation, and vehicle soundproofing due to its flexibility and strong sound absorption properties.
In moisture-prone areas and spaces requiring rigid form factors, foamed plastic materials like expanded polystyrene and polyurethane foam are often used, though concerns over combustibility may influence their selection. The rising demand for sustainable construction practices has led to a surge in the use of natural materials such as cork, wool, recycled denim, and cellulose fibers. These environmentally friendly alternatives appeal to both residential and commercial clients who prioritize indoor air quality and low environmental impact. Beyond conventional materials, cutting-edge innovations such as aerogel-based composites and hybrid polymer blends are gaining traction in specialized applications that require extremely high performance in limited space. These advanced materials are particularly relevant for sectors such as aerospace, clean rooms, and precision manufacturing facilities. As urban density increases, so does the need for effective noise control in high-rise buildings, apartments, offices, and mixed-use developments.
Developers are now routinely incorporating acoustic design principles into early-stage architectural planning to ensure optimal noise isolation between rooms, floors, and exterior sources. Government mandates on building acoustics have further bolstered demand, especially in public housing, schools, and hospitals. In the automotive and transportation industry, vehicle manufacturers are ramping up the integration of sound insulation to meet consumer expectations for quieter cabin environments. This trend is especially visible in the rise of electric vehicles, where the absence of engine noise brings other mechanical and road noises to the forefront, demanding more sophisticated soundproofing materials. Meanwhile, the industrial sector utilizes acoustic insulation in machinery housing, power generation units, and HVAC equipment to mitigate workplace noise and ensure compliance with occupational safety regulations. Insulation is also critical for maintaining operational efficiency and reducing downtime caused by noise-related fatigue or equipment malfunction.
Specialized industries such as aerospace, defense, pharmaceuticals, and electronics are increasingly adopting acoustic insulation for their controlled environments, where precision, safety, and quality control are paramount. These sectors often require bespoke solutions tailored to exacting standards of performance and durability. The rise of decentralized energy facilities, including renewables, substations, and microgrids, is also creating new opportunities for acoustic insulation, particularly in noise-sensitive rural or residential zones.
